Zinc oxide. Zinc oxide is a unique and very useful material, used in the manufacture of rubber tyres, skin products (such as zinc cream, anti-dandruff shampoos, antiseptic ointments and calamine lotion for healing skin disorders), paints, floor coverings, plastics (to help prevent them cracking) and ceramic glazes. Zinc Mining and Processing: Everything you Need to Know

The Zinc Mining Process. The zinc mining process is conducted primarily underground, with more than 80 percent of all zinc extracted beneath the Earth's surface. Turning dust into a commodity: ZincOx's Andrew Woollett talks zinc

Andrew Woollett: We realised there was an interesting opportunity in urban resources i.e. waste material, in electric arc furnace dust. The biggest use of zinc is in galvanising, which is simply coating a thin layer of zinc on steel to stop it rusting. Zinc Oxide | ZnO | CID 3007857

Zinc oxide is a nutrient supplement. Zinc oxide is a constituent of cigarette filters for removal of selected components from tobacco smoke. Zinc oxide is a filter consisting of charcoal impregnated with zinc oxide and iron oxide removes significant amounts of HCN and H2S from tobacco smoke without affecting its flavor. Mineral Commodity Summaries 2022

Prepared by Amy C. Tolcin [(703) 648–4940, [email protected]] ZINC (Data in thousand metric tons of contained zinc unless otherwise noted) Domestic Production and Use: The value of zinc mined in 2021, based on zinc contained in concentrate, was about $2.4 billion. Zinc was mined in five States at seven mining operations by five companies.
